TL;DR Summary

OpenAI’s foray into ads with ChatGPT is developing into a potential new revenue engine that could threaten Google's search ads. Early Similarweb data shows ChatGPT ads target conversational intent rather than keywords, with “intent drift” meaning ads can appear as a chat progresses. Ads currently command around $60 CPM and roughly $12 CPC, with an average CTR near 0.68% and some campaigns hitting higher performance. Users tend to continue the conversation after an ad—about 73% of the time—suggesting the ads function as contextual recommendations rather than intrusive placements. If OpenAI can monetize effectively while preserving user experience, this could reshape how online advertising works and impact Google’s dominance in search ads.
